Prima, $0.02/$0.04 No Limit Hold'em Cash, 5 Players
Poker Tools Powered By Holdem Manager - The Ultimate Poker Software Suite.

SB: $5.04 (126 bb)
BB: $16.21 (405.3 bb)
MP: $4 (100 bb)
Hero (CO): $4.06 (101.5 bb)
BTN: $2.18 (54.5 bb)

Preflop: Hero is CO with 6 6
MP folds, Hero raises to $0.12, 2 folds, BB raises to $0.36, Hero calls $0.24

Flop: ($0.74) 3 4 8 (2 players)
BB checks, Hero bets $0.44, BB calls $0.44

Turn: ($1.62) 2 (2 players)
BB checks, Hero checks

River: ($1.62) A (2 players)
BB bets $0.80, Hero calls $0.80

Results:

Spoiler

$3.22 pot ($0.10 rake)
Final Board: 3 4 8 2 A
BB showed A Q and won $3.12 ($1.52 net)
Hero mucked 6 6 and lost (-$1.60 net)

opponent is laggy 35/18/2.4 aggression 71% cbet 19% 3bet from the blinds,
he has calling station tendencies against me as I have tried to bluff him a bit

is the flat call preflop against this type of opponent ok? Does it make a big difference if i have 77-TT?

He is likely going to 3-bet mostly Ax hands rather than random hands.
I would prefer betting myself 0.8$ and then check back river, as played I think call is fine, since he would likely bluff all his Kx, Qx hands.
I don´t think there is too much different besides 55-77, he should also not valuebet 8x, but if you have TT then he might valuebet 99.
